Otto W. G. Pfefferkorn

These three pictures capture the life of our famous grandfather Otto.

Here is the dapper Otto in the later years of his life.


Here is Dr. Otto W.G. Pfefferkorn where at Brenau College in Gainesville GA he founded the Conservatory of Music and served as its Dean for 37 years until his death in 1939


And lastly, here is Otto in regal splendor during his days as a famous concert pianist who performed all over the world.

The Children of Otto and Josephine Pfefferkorn



This picture was taken in August 1909. My dad Robert was the oldest, born 5 May 1902, then son Lawrence born in 1904 followed 2 years later by daughter Delphine, and a year after that, the youngest in this family, Stanley.
